How do you clean fake suede?
- Brush the shoe with a suede brush.
- Use a slightly dampened cloth (lint-free) and a synthetic shoe cleaner or a mild soap (hand soap, for example; or if the stain is oil-based, a degreasing dish soap) to clean heavily soiled areas.
- Blot the stain with a dry, clean cloth.
- Allow the shoe to air-dry.

Also to know is, can you wash faux suede?
For machine-washable items, always wash faux suede items together to prevent the material from collecting lint. To be on the safe side, always use the delicate or gentle cycle and a mild liquid detergent when washing faux suede. To hand wash your item, fill a large bowl or sink with warm, soapy water.
Furthermore, how do you get scuffs out of faux suede shoes? Instructions
- If the mark you want to clean is already dry, first brush the suede with a soft brush to bring up the pile and expose the dirt.
- Rub an eraser over the stain.
- Take an almost-dry sponge and rub the affected area to remove even more surface dirt.
- Finally, give the item a good brush.
Considering this, how do you clean microsuede fabric?
To clean your microsuede furniture, vacuum it once a week to remove crumbs and dust. You can also remove odors from your furniture by sprinkling powdered laundry detergent on it, gently brushing the detergent into the fabric, then vacuuming it up. If you're treating spills or stains, wipe them up as quickly as you can.

Steps to Remove the Stains:- First, allow the suede to fully air dry.
- The easiest way to remove water marks from suede is to rub up the nap of the suede.
- If the towel or suede brush doesn't fully remove the stains, use a pencil eraser.
- If the stains are stubborn, rub the area lightly with an embory board or sandpaper.
